Established in 1990, Chopin Theatre has had approximately 1,400 events with over 7,000 presentations of theater, film, literature, music, dance, and more, including over 110 of its own productions. Chosen as one of the "Chicago Venues that Matter the Most," Chopin Theatre has hosted performers from every state in the U.S. and from over 40 countries, including many from Eastern Europe in particular.

Chicago's Art Institute is indeed one of the best museums in America and perhaps even the world! It is famous for its French Impressionism collection, but that's definitely not the only notable sections of its vast permanent exhibits. While you should still admire the masterpieces from Van Gogh and Monet, you must also explore the other sections of the museums! To name a few, you will find an expansive Hellenistic collection spanning the its whole time frame, an impressive Asian collection with enough works to fill a grand temple, and an awesome European weapon collection befitting for an army. Anyway, plan to stay here for at least a half day because the Art Institute is full of treasures.

Space buffs must go to the Adler Planetarium to enjoy the exhibitions and the movies. I definitely recommend Destination Solar System....both interesting and educational. Outside the planetarium on the river edge there is a telescope and you climb this platform and you are able to see the sun and its solar flairs live... It's beautiful and amazing and free! So, if you are planning to visit Adler Planetarium, don't forget to check it out this telescope outside the building at the lake edge while getting a fantastic view of the city skyline. It's worth it!

Located on Navy Pier, this is our country's most acclaimed Shakespeare theatre. The productions are world class on every level. If you haven't seen a play here, you're missing out on a great evening. It's not the boring Shakespeare you were forced to read in high school. The plays come to life on this main stage. There are major action sequences, lightning and thunder, canons, music, and even singing and dancing. And they feature award winning directors and actors. Tickets are surprisingly affordable...If you're under 35, you can buy two tickets for $20 each. And even regularly priced tickets are not expensive. Parking at Navy Pier is discounted for you as well.

It's easy to overlook this restaurant, since it is just off of Randolph's restaurant row and on an obscure side street. Anyway, it's the real deal, with all the classic French comfort foods, impeccably prepared. It's really the small details that make the difference: the warm, crusty French bread and sweet butter served before you even order; the exactly correct Dijon mustard that accompanies the country-style house-made terrine of pork pate; the croutons on your Salad Lyonnaise that have obviously just been toasted; the perfect crust of gruyere on the French onion soup; and of course the right ambiance and soundtrack to accompany a classic French bistro meal. Go on Tuesday night!

A bit off the beaten track, but totally worth the trek for the PEKING DUCK DINNER (not on the menu, but just tell the server what you want). Great place for big parties - birthdays, family reunion, etc. The duck dinner comes with one full duck (w/ 6 baos + veggies), a big bowl of soup (made from the bones of the duck), and duck fried rice (made from the extra meat on the duck). It is about $40 for the combo but you can easily split it between 3-4 people for a good value. Also, the egg rolls are fantastic. BYOB with a $10 per bottle corkage fee.

Open early, and serving breakfast and lunch menus 7-days, there are certain things patrons of Lou's have come to expect: being greeted at the door with a hot donut hole, being expediently served by a professional and happy staff, complimentary Milk Duds on the table, an orange slice and a single prune as an "amuse," and an offer of free ice cream upon the completion of your meal. Expect quality ingredients, meticulous preparation, and large servings of the menu items. Be sure to include Lou Mitchell's on your "must" list...Especially for those who pine for a time when things were "better" in America, Lou Mitchell's will transport you there.

The Fine Arts Building, located on Michigan Avenue across from Grant Park, is one of Chicago's lesser known architectural gems. It maintains much of its nostalgia with the old-fashioned elevator operators (Where else will you experience the thrill of bouncing up and down vigorously to get to the right floor level, jostled by a friendly old guy operating a lever?!). The monthly Second Friday's of the month are a great opportunity to tour the many unique studios, meet and mingle with the artists, purchase jewelry and artwork, and listen to performing artists. A must-see if you're in the neighborhood...if only for the manual elevators!
